Chile Chocolate Ice Cream

This ice cream gets an extra kick from the spice, which also highlights the richness of the chocolate. Because I only eyeballed it and your preferences may differ, all spices are to taste.

Prep Time: 5 mins
Additional Time: 20 mins
Total Time: 25 mins
Servings: 8
Yield: 1 quart

Ingredients

  1. ½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  2. ½ cup white sugar
  3. 1 teaspoon chile powder, or to taste
  4. 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on, or to taste
  5. ½ teaspoon cayenne pepper, or to taste
  6. 1 ¼ cups milk
  7. ¾ cup heavy whipping cream

Instructions

  1. Mix cocoa powder, sugar, chile powder, cinnamon, and cayenne together in a bowl.
  2. Stir milk and heavy cream into cocoa mixture until well combined.
  3. Pour mixture into a home ice cream maker; freeze according to manufacturer’s instructions, about 20 minutes. Transfer to a covered container and freeze until firm.
  4. For a good no-churn alternative, fold whipped cream in with the mixture in place of using the heavy whipping cream.
